Referral Process

​The main component of a Wayside House referral is completion of the Global Appraisal of Individual Needs (GAIN) and/or the Admission and Discharge Criteria and Assessment Tool (ADAT). These assessments can be completed by qualified counsellors in a variety of addiction service settings. For example, applicants who reside in Hamilton can have a GAIN assessment completed through Alcohol, Drug and Gambling Services. 

The minimum required documents for a completed referral are:


  • GAIN or ADAT, including consents to release information by referral source
  • Standardized Residential Services Referral Form
  • Medical Evaluation Form

The assessment package should then be emailed, faxed or hard copy mailed to Wayside House for our review. Please note that we require all assessment and referral packages be complete in accordance to the Standardized Referral Package for Residential Services as endorsed by Addictions and Mental Health Ontario. 

In addition to the above documents, Wayside House may require additional documents to ensure a safe and appropriate referral. These can include: a current prescription list direct from your pharmacy; legal documentation detailing prohibitions, summons and/or conditions; and relevant psychiatric documentation.

Admissions Criteria

Wayside House makes every effort to accommodate incoming referrals; however, there are certain admission criteria that are crucial to our program vision. Potential clients must be:

  • Men, aged 18 and over, experiencing substance dependency
  • In a physical and mental condition that allows full participation in a structured, intensive treatment program; this determination is made carefully and with reference to all relevant medical documentation 
  • Committed to abstinence-based recovery goals
  • Willing to contribute to and foster an environment that is respectful, recovery- and solution-oriented, and free of all kinds of discrimination. ​​
